Fabulous! My first sangria made and it was an absolute HIT with a very large party. I did read all the reviews and made slight modifications. I went crazy with the fruit selection and skipped on the lemons. I added a lime, an orange, 2 kiwi's, cherries (sliced and pitted - fresh), raspberries (fresh), fresh apricots (sliced), 1 apple (sliced), 1 peach (sliced), and 2 pears (the red kind). I chose for my wine Sutter Home White Merlot. I was very nervous about the wine choice but White Merlot is not sweet like Arbor Mist yet not as "dry" as a red table wine/merlot/cab/pinot noir. I still added the sugar and the Orange Juice.
Note: I went with a few reviews and used the Bacardi Razz Rum (raspberry rum) and used the full 1.5-2 cups. However, I used that amount with 2 1.5 L bottles of wine so I would agree that if I was making this recipe as originally stated I would use no more than 1 cup of rum.
HUGE hit. Brought it to a friend's family party where people were being conservative in drinking alcohol and it was gone within 2 hours flat.
The best part (and no-waste part)...we took the remains home (the fruit) and food processed it into a HUGE batch of smoothie for tomorrow night. VERY potent and super yummy.
